                            - Tenure
 - First elected to the Maryland House of Delegates, 2006. Member of the House since 2007.
 
- Current Assignments
 - 
                                                
- 2011- Deputy Majority Whip
 
- 2015 Economic Matters Committee
 
- 2015 Chair, Workers' Compensation Subcommittee of the Economic Matters Committee
 
- 2015 Banking, Economic Development, Science & Technology Subcommittee of the Economic Matters Committee
 
- 2015 Unemployment Insurance Subcommittee of the Economic Matters Committee
 
- 2015 House Chair, Worker's Compensation Benefit and Insurance Oversight Committee
 
- 2007- Women Legislators of Maryland
 
- 2016 First Vice Chair, Maryland Legislative Asian American and Pacific Islander Caucus, Inc.
 
 
- Past House Service
 - Judiciary Committee, 2007-2015; Juvenile Law Subcommittee of the Judiciary Committee, 2007-2015.
 
- Public Service
 - Criminal Justice Information Advisory Board, 2010-2015; Governor's Family Violence Council, 2008-; Maryland State Council for Interstate Adult Offender Supervision, 2007-; Law Enforcement and State-Appointed Boards Committee, Prince Georges County Delegation (Vice Chair 2008-10); Chair (2011-2014)., 2007-.
 
- Memberships
 - Chair, Asian Pacific American Democratic Caucus of Maryland, 1996-1997; Filipino Inter-Collegiate Network Dialogue, 1993-1996; Asian Pacific American Labor Alliance, AFL-CIO, 1992-; Philippine American Cultural Arts Society, 1985-1990; Communications Director, International Chamber of Asian & American Business Executives; Prince George's County Chapter, National Association for the Advancement of Colored People (NAACP); National Philippine Cultural Foundation, Inc.; Southern Christian Leadership Conference; Young Democrats of Maryland.
 
- Biographical Information
 - Born, Washington, DC; Oxon Hill Senior High School; Salisbury State University, B.S., Respiratory Therapy, 1996; Certified Respiratory Therapist, Inova Fairfax Hospital, 1996-98; Anchor and Co-host, Valderrama's America, 1997-; Executive Staff, Office of International President, American Federation of State, County & Municipal Employees (AFSCME), 1992-93, 98-2001; Strategic Communications Specialist, Public Affairs Department, American Federation of State, County & Municipal Employees (AFSCME), 2001-; Member, St. Columba Church; Married, Two daughters.
